Saap Saap Thai brings the authentic essence of Thai street food to Singapore through its halal-certified menu that captures the vibrant flavors of Thailand's bustling food scene. This casual self-service restaurant specializes in traditional Thai dishes prepared with fresh herbs, spices, and authentic recipes that deliver genuine Thai taste experiences.
The restaurant's menu features classic Thai favorites including aromatic Tom Yum soup, flavorful Pad Thai, rich green curry, and zesty papaya salad alongside signature items like basil beef and chicken, and tender beef brisket noodles. Each dish is carefully prepared using traditional cooking methods and quality ingredients, ensuring the authentic flavors that Thai cuisine enthusiasts expect.
Located at Our Tampines Hub with a modern ordering system where customers order through digital screens, Saap Saap Thai offers excellent value with freshly prepared dishes at competitive prices. The restaurant has earned recognition for delivering authentic Thai flavors without compromising on halal certification, making it accessible to Singapore's diverse dining community while maintaining the true spirit of Thai street food culture.

The Pad Thai is served wet style. The flavour is okay, but it was too soft and wet for my personal liking, although the seafood ingredients were considerably generous. Overall, the taste is more commercial, so it's not the place if you're looking for authentic Thai food.

Ordering via the self-service kiosk was easy. Service was prompt, even on a weekend dinner. You need to find a seat/table before ordering. The combo meals seem quite value for money. The boat noodles were average, not too sweet. The meat was tender, but the softness of the tendons varied. The fried chicken was crispy, and the mango sticky rice was average. The lemongrass drinks were not too sweet and refreshing.

Ordered the beef noodle set using the self-service kiosk and self-collected at the counter when the buzzer alerted. The beef noodle set included a drink (I chose Cha Red Tea Jelly), beef noodles, and two fried chicken pieces (a wing and a drumette), costing $13.90. It was an average meal considering the price.

If you're missing halal Thai boat noodles, you must come here. The beef is very tender and very close to Thai street food. The fried chicken noodles are also very good. The Thai milk tea with black pearls is quite unique; it pops in your mouth and isn't the chewy type. I liked the mango ice cream they put in one of the Thai milk teas, but when mixed, it didn't taste as nice. You'd better stick to the standard Thai milk tea. For dessert, the mango sticky rice is small but adequate to make you full. The mango sago is also okay if you're craving that salty and sweet combination. Overall, if you are really craving halal Thai noodles, this is the place for you. It's similar to halal street noodles in Thailand.
